5. TRAINING AND CONFERENCES

5.1. Initial Training Program. The Operating Partner and your initial managers must attend and successfully complete our initial training program before you open your Restaurant. Our initial training program includes: (a) approximately one (1) week of franchise management training conducted at our company-owned Restaurant or any other location we designate; and (b) approximately two (2) weeks of onsite training and grand opening assistance, as described in §5.2. If you are a multi-unit franchisee and this Agreement is for your second (2nd) or subsequent Restaurant, we reserve the right to limit or waive certain aspects of our initial training program, and provide you with a corresponding reduction or waiver of the initial training fee, based on our

subjective assessment of the qualifications and experience of you and your management team. If you hire a new manager or appoint a new Operating Partner after we conduct our preopening initial training program, the new manager or Operating Partner, as applicable, must attend and successfully complete our then-current initial training program before assuming responsibility for the management of your Restaurant.

  • 5.2. Onsite Training and Opening Assistance. At no additional cost to you, we will send a representative to your Restaurant to provide approximately two (2) weeks of onsite training and assistance with the grand opening of your Restaurant.
  • 5.3. Ongoing Training Programs. We may offer periodic refresher or supplemental training courses for your Operating Partner and/or managers. We may designate each training program as mandatory or optional.

What This Means (2024 FDD)

According to Chop5 Salad Kitchen's 2024 Franchise Disclosure Document, the Operating Partner must attend and successfully complete the initial training program before the restaurant opens. This program includes approximately one week of franchise management training at a company-owned restaurant or another designated location. Additionally, the Operating Partner will receive approximately two weeks of onsite training and grand opening assistance at the franchisee's location.

If a new Operating Partner is appointed after the initial training, they must also attend and successfully complete the then-current initial training program before assuming management responsibilities. Chop5 Salad Kitchen may also offer periodic refresher or supplemental training courses for the Operating Partner, designating these programs as either mandatory or optional.

Furthermore, if Chop5 Salad Kitchen determines that a restaurant is not operating in full compliance with the Franchise Agreement or the Manual, the Operating Partner may be required to attend remedial training to address operational deficiencies. Any new Operating Partner must successfully complete the current initial training program before supervising, managing, or operating the restaurant.
